Default Re: ***OFFICIAL 8G Suspension Thread***

Your issue may be the way the coils are wound. Normally with progressive rate springs, you'll see a bunch of closely wound coils near the top. Sometimes these coils can rub on each other on compression and cause some noise.

Tein sells a specific product to deal with this: http://www.tein.com/products/silencer_rubber.html

OR, you can wrap the coils that are close to each other with spiral cable wrap; something like this: .

It's worth a shot. Also, double check all your bolts (and re-torque) everything.

After putting the car on a lift myself and not trusting the dealership I found that the dealer had re-installed the spring wrong and that the lower spring was not seated in the pocket at all, it was about a 1/4 turn off. I have seen the isolator wrap and have some on the springs. The stuff works great, Eibach has said that after a period of time the isolators may move.

Subjective question deserves a subjective answer. Simply asking if x brand is good does not warrant for a detailed answer.

That is beside the point.

FF uses cheap materials, lack of differentiation between dampening settings, poor dampening to begin with, poor customer service. There's a dedicated/official FF thread in A&C. Try checking there also. Some say they swear by this brand, but I am not convinced. It's all about what you want to do and what you want out of the suspension.

What are you looking to do? Dump it (form >> function), track it (function > form), just lowering? What's your budget?
